Totu\u0219i, exper\u021bii avertizeaz\u0103 c\u0103 acest scenariu devine tot mai plauzibil odat\u0103 cu lansarea accelerat\u0103 a mii de sateli\u021bi pe orbit\u0103, scrie <a href=\"https:\/\/www.euronews.com\/next\/2026\/02\/06\/space-junk-may-threaten-flight-delays-as-satellites-crowd-earths-orbit\" target=\"_blank\" rel=\"noopener\">Euronews<\/a>.<\/p>\n<p id=\"p-1\">Un studiu publicat \u00een Scientific Reports relev\u0103 o probabilitate anual\u0103 de 26% ca reintrarea necontrolat\u0103 a unei rachete s\u0103 traverseze spa\u021bii aeriene aglomerate, precum Europa de Nord, nord-estul Statelor Unite sau marile hub-uri din Asia-Pacific. Acest lucru nu \u00eenseamn\u0103 c\u0103 o coliziune este inevitabil\u0103. Se indic\u0103 doar faptul c\u0103 autorit\u0103\u021bile vor fi nevoite s\u0103 suspende zborurile temporar din motive de siguran\u021b\u0103.<\/p>\n<div id=\"attachment_23682720\" class=\"wp-caption aligncenter\" readability=\"33\"><img aria-describedby=\"caption-attachment-23682720\" class=\"wp-image-23682720 size-full\" src=\"https:\/\/microscopemedia.com\/wp-content\/uploads\/2026\/02\/pericolul-real-al-deseurilor-orbitale-cat-de-mari-sunt-riscurile-pentru-aviatie.webp\" alt width=\"700\" height=\"457\" loading=\"lazy\" decoding=\"async\" srcset=\"https:\/\/microscopemedia.com\/wp-content\/uploads\/2026\/02\/pericolul-real-al-deseurilor-orbitale-cat-de-mari-sunt-riscurile-pentru-aviatie-1.webp 500w, https:\/\/microscopemedia.com\/wp-content\/uploads\/2026\/02\/pericolul-real-al-deseurilor-orbitale-cat-de-mari-sunt-riscurile-pentru-aviatie.webp 728w\"><\/p>\n<p id=\"caption-attachment-23682720\" class=\"wp-caption-text\">United Airlines Boeing 737 MAX suspiciune de lovire de\u0219euri spatiale \u00een zbor. Sursa foto: X\/Breaking Aviation News &amp; Videos<\/p>\n<\/div>\n<h2 id=\"chapter-0\">De ce se \u00eenchide spa\u021biul aerian de\u0219i riscul e minim?<\/h2>\n<p id=\"p-2\">Potrivit EUROCONTROL, organiza\u021bia care gestioneaz\u0103 traficul aerian \u00een 42 de \u021b\u0103ri europene, riscul real de coliziune \u00eentre un avion \u0219i resturi spa\u021biale este estimat la o dat\u0103 la un milion de ani. Cu toate acestea, problema nu este impactul \u00een sine, ci traseul previzionat al resturilor, care poate intersecta rute intens circulate. \u00cen astfel de situa\u021bii, autorit\u0103\u021bile prefer\u0103 s\u0103 \u00eenchid\u0103 spa\u021biul aerian ca m\u0103sur\u0103 de precau\u021bie.<\/p>\n<p id=\"p-3\">Un exemplu clar a avut loc \u00een 2022, c\u00e2nd fragmente dintr-o rachet\u0103 chineze\u0219ti au for\u021bat \u00eenchiderea spa\u021biului aerian al Spaniei \u0219i Fran\u021bei. Sute de zboruri au fost \u00eent\u00e2rziate, gener\u00e2nd costuri de milioane de euro, de\u0219i resturile au c\u0103zut \u00een final \u00een ocean.<\/p>\n<blockquote class=\"twitter-tweet\" data-media-max-width=\"560\" readability=\"6.7228915662651\">\n<p dir=\"ltr\" lang=\"en\" id=\"p-4\">This is NOT what you want to see out of your plane window\u2026.debris from Starship 7 \ud83d\udc40<a href=\"https:\/\/t.co\/M8Za4GwTBZ\">pic.twitter.com\/M8Za4GwTBZ<\/a><\/p>\n<p id=\"p-5\">\u2014 Volcaholic \ud83c\udf0b (@volcaholic1) <a href=\"https:\/\/twitter.com\/volcaholic1\/status\/1880082112398913771?ref_src=twsrc%5Etfw\">January 17, 2025<\/a><\/p>\n<\/blockquote>\n<p id=\"p-7\">Echipamentele spa\u021biale sunt construite s\u0103 reziste condi\u021biilor extreme. Conform Agen\u021biei Spa\u021biale Europene (ESA), multe componente nu se dezintegreaz\u0103 complet la reintrarea \u00een atmosfer\u0103. Rezervoarele de combustibil din titan, de exemplu, rezist\u0103 temperaturilor ridicate. Din acest motiv, pot ajunge la altitudini joase, reprezent\u00e2nd un pericol real pentru avia\u021bie. Analistii descriu aceste obiecte ca fiind \u201ebuc\u0103\u021bi de metal scoase dintr-un cuptor\u201d.<\/p>\n<h2 id=\"chapter-1\">Misiunea DRACO: Cercetare prin autodistrugere<\/h2>\n<p id=\"p-8\">Pentru a \u00een\u021belege mai bine acest fenomen, Agen\u021bia Spa\u021bial\u0103 European\u0103 preg\u0103te\u0219te misiunea DRACO, programat\u0103 pentru 2027. Este vorba despre un satelit de m\u0103rimea unei ma\u0219ini de sp\u0103lat, conceput s\u0103 se autodistrug\u0103 controlat. \u00cen interiorul s\u0103u, o capsul\u0103 rezistent\u0103, echipat\u0103 cu sute de senzori \u0219i camere, va \u00eenregistra \u00een timp real temperaturile \u0219i stresul structural. Datele vor fi transmise \u00eenainte ca fragmentele finale s\u0103 cad\u0103 \u00een ocean. Astfel, se vor oferi informa\u021bii pre\u021bioase, imposibil de ob\u021binut prin simul\u0103ri la sol.<\/p>\n<p id=\"p-9\">Scopul pe termen lung este proiectarea sateli\u021bilor \u201edemisabili\u201d, construi\u021bi s\u0103 se dezintegreze complet \u00eenainte de a atinge altitudinile de croazier\u0103 ale avioanelor comerciale. Inginerii testeaz\u0103 componente care favorizeaz\u0103 fragmentarea \u0219i materiale alternative titanului, precum aliajele de aluminiu. De asemenea, se urm\u0103\u0219te ca reintr\u0103rile controlate, direc\u021bionate spre zone izolate ale oceanului, s\u0103 devin\u0103 standardul pentru rachetele mari.<\/p>\n<h2 id=\"chapter-2\">Un cer tot mai aglomerat, riscuri pentru avia\u021bie<\/h2>\n<p id=\"p-10\">Traficul aerian european ar putea cre\u0219te cu p\u00e2n\u0103 la 2,4% anual p\u00e2n\u0103 \u00een 2050. \u00cen acela\u0219i timp, apar noi categorii de \u201eutilizatori ai cerului\u201d: turi\u0219ti spa\u021biali suborbitali, baloane de mare altitudine, drone VTOL pentru pasageri \u0219i, \u00een viitor, vehicule hipersonice. Aceast\u0103 complexitate necesit\u0103 o coordonare str\u00e2ns\u0103 \u00eentre avia\u021bie \u0219i sectorul spa\u021bial. EUROCONTROL lucreaz\u0103 la un sistem permanent de monitorizare \u00een timp real, oferind o imagine integrat\u0103 de la sol p\u00e2n\u0103 pe orbita joas\u0103.<\/p>\n<p id=\"p-11\"><a href=\"https:\/\/www.mediafax.ro\/externe\/bulgaria-va-monitoriza-deseurile-spatiale-alaturi-de-partenerii-din-ue-23666175\" target=\"_blank\" rel=\"noopener\">De\u0219eurile spa\u021biale<\/a> nu vor deveni imediat cauza principal\u0103 a \u00eent\u00e2rzierilor de zbor. Totu\u0219i, pe m\u0103sur\u0103 ce orbita terestr\u0103 se aglomereaz\u0103, \u00eenchiderea preventiv\u0103 a spa\u021biului aerian ar putea deveni mai frecvent\u0103.<\/p>\n","protected":false},"excerpt":{"rendered":"<p>Dac\u0103 \u00eent\u00e2rzierile cauzate de condi\u021biile meteo sunt frecvente \u00een avia\u021bie, cele generate de resturile spa\u021biale sunt \u00eenc\u0103 neobi\u0219nuite.
